Mountainair Ranger District Plans Prescribe Burn
Mountainair, NM – September 26, 2012. The Cibola
National Forest and Grasslands’ Mountainair Ranger District is planning a
prescribed burn in the Manzano Mountains. The Wester (A1) Prescribed Burn will
encompass approximately 16 acres located on the south side of Forest Road 275
and north of the Thunderbird private property. The goal of this project is to
improve watershed and wildlife biodiversity and to protect private property in
the event of a wildfire.
Mountainair Ranger District fire staff has been closely
monitoring fuel moisture conditions and weather patterns. If conditions remain
favorable, the prescribed burn will occur on Wednesday, October 3, 2012. Fire
management crews will monitor the burn for as long as necessary after ignition
to ensure public safety.
Members of the Southwest Conservation Corps (SCC) Veterans
Green Corps will assist Forest Service personnel in the prescribed burn. The
Cibola National Forest and Grasslands is partnering with the SCC to provide
veterans with land management and wildland firefighting training experience.
During the prescribed burn, NFS Roads 275 and 422 will have
temporary road signs warning about smoke and activity on the roads and some
light smoke may observed in the area. Additional fire vehicles will be in the
area patrolling and monitoring the roads. Please drive carefully when on these
roads, as visibility might be lowered due to smoke.
